repo.or.cz
/
unicorn.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Merge branch 'benchmark'
2009-05-22
Eric Wong
Merg
e
branc
h
'benchmark'
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Define HttpR
e
quest#rese
t
if missing
commit
|
commitdiff
|
tree
2009-05-22
Eric
W
o
n
g
Merge b
r
an
c
h
'0
.
7
.
x-stable'
commit
|
commitdiff
|
tree
2009-05-22
Eric
Wo
n
g
GNUma
k
efile
:
glob all files in b
i
n/*
commit
|
commitdiff
|
tree
2009-05-22
Eric W
o
ng
Dis
a
bl
e
forma
t
ting
for com
m
and-
l
ine switches
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
test
_
response: corre
c
t OFS test
commit
|
commitdiff
|
tree
2009-05-22
E
r
i
c
Wong
http_response:
allo
w
string status
codes
commit
|
commitdiff
|
tree
2009-05-22
Eric
Wong
Enforce minim
u
m timeout
a
t 3 seconds
commit
|
commitdiff
|
tree
2009-05-22
Eri
c
Won
g
configurator: fix
r
doc formatting
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Preserve
1
.
9 IO encodings
in reope
n
_logs
commit
|
commitdiff
|
tree
2009-05-22
E
r
ic Wong
F
i
x a warn
i
ng about @pid being
u
ni
n
itialized
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
T
UNING: add
a note abo
u
t somaxcon
n
with
UNIX s
o
ckets
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
Igno
r
e unhandled
m
as
t
er s
i
g
n
als in the worke
r
s
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
S
afer t
i
meout hand
l
in
g
and test case
commit
|
commitdiff
|
tree
2009-05-22
Eric
W
o
ng
app/old_rails:
c
orr
e
ctly lo
g
error
s
in output
commit
|
commitdiff
|
tree
2009-05-22
Eric Wo
n
g
Add TUNING
d
ocum
e
nt
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
ap
p
/exec_cg
i
: GC p
r
e
vention
commit
|
commitdiff
|
tree
2009-05-22
Eri
c
Wong
A
dd
exam
p
le init script
commit
|
commitdiff
|
tree
2009-05-22
Eric Wo
n
g
test_upload: still uncom
f
ortable with
1
.
9 IO en
c
oding
.
.
.
commit
|
commitdiff
|
tree
2009-05-22
Eric Wong
test_request: e
n
able with Ruby 1
.
9 now Rack
1
.
0
.
0 is ou
t
commit
|
commitdiff
|
tree
2009-05-21
Eri
c
Wong
GN
U
ma
k
efile: glob all files in
b
in/*
commit
|
commitdiff
|
tree
2009-05-21
Eric Wong
D
i
sable f
o
rmatt
i
ng fo
r
co
m
m
and-line switches
commit
|
commitdiff
|
tree
2009-05-13
Eric Wong
privatize constants only used by old_rails/static
commit
|
commitdiff
|
tree
2009-05-13
Eri
c
Wong
test_re
s
po
n
se: correct OFS
test
commit
|
commitdiff
|
tree
2009-05-13
Eric Wong
http_response: a
l
l
o
w stri
n
g status cod
e
s
commit
|
commitdiff
|
tree
2009-05-13
Eric Wong
Require
R
a
ck
for HTTP Statu
s
c
o
des
commit
|
commitdiff
|
tree
2009-05-12
Eric Wong
Reopen master logs on
S
I
GHUP, to
o
commit
|
commitdiff
|
tree
2009-05-12
Eric W
o
ng
exec_cgi: don't assu
m
e the
b
ody#eac
h
co
n
sumer is a
.
.
.
commit
|
commitdiff
|
tree
2009-05-11
Eric Wong
HttpReques
t
::DEF_PARAMS => HttpRequest
:
:DEFA
U
L
TS
commit
|
commitdiff
|
tree
2009-05-11
Eric
Wong
Remove
trick
l
etest
commit
|
commitdiff
|
tree
2009-05-11
E
ric Wong
Avo
i
d killing
s
leeping
w
orkers
commit
|
commitdiff
|
tree
2009-05-11
Eric
W
ong
Enforce mini
m
u
m
timeout at 3 seconds
commit
|
commitdiff
|
tree
2009-05-11
Eric Wong
app
/
exec_cgi:
u
se explicit buffe
r
s for
r
ead/sy
s
read
commit
|
commitdiff
|
tree
2009-05-11
Er
i
c Wong
http_
r
equest:
u
se Rack::InputWrapper-compatible me
t
hods
commit
|
commitdiff
|
tree
2009-05-11
Eric Wong
configu
r
ator:
f
ix rdoc formatti
n
g
commit
|
commitdiff
|
tree
2009-05-04
Eric Won
g
Preserve 1
.
9
IO
e
ncodi
n
gs
i
n
reopen_
l
ogs
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
Inline and remo
v
e the HttpRe
q
u
e
st#r
e
s
e
t method
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
Fix a warning about @pid
being unini
t
ialized
commit
|
commitdiff
|
tree
2009-05-04
Eric Won
g
S
peed u
p
the worker ac
c
ept loop
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
test_signals: ready workers before
con
n
ecting
commit
|
commitdiff
|
tree
2009-05-04
E
ric Wong
I
nstant s
h
utdown
s
igna
l
s
r
eally m
e
an inst
a
nt
s
hutdown
commit
|
commitdiff
|
tree
2009-05-04
Eric Wong
Remove redundan
t
socket
closin
g
/check
i
ng
commit
|
commitdiff
|
tree
2009-05-04
Eric Won
g
TU
N
ING: add a
note
a
bout s
o
maxconn with UNIX sockets
commit
|
commitdiff
|
tree
2009-05-04
Eric
W
o
ng
Igno
r
e unh
a
ndled master signals in t
h
e
worker
s
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
Safer tim
e
out handling a
n
d t
e
st case
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
M
e
r
ge commit '
o
rigin/benc
h
ma
r
k
'
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
No point in unsetting t
h
e O_NONBLOCK fl
a
g
commit
|
commitdiff
|
tree
2009-05-03
Eric Won
g
h
t
t
p
_request: switch to readpartial
o
ver s
y
s
r
e
ad
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
b
e
nchmark/*: updates for newer versions
o
f
Uni
c
orn
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
h
t
t
p
_respo
n
se: l
u
ser
s
pace buffe
r
ing
i
s
barely faste
r
commit
|
commitdiff
|
tree
2009-05-03
Er
i
c Wo
n
g
http_request: avoid StringIO
.
n
ew for
GET/HEAD requests
commit
|
commitdiff
|
tree
2009-05-03
Eric Wong
app/old
_
rai
l
s:
c
orr
e
ctly log
errors in
out
p
u
t
commit
|
commitdiff
|
tree
2009-05-03
Eric
W
ong
Make
s
pecu
l
a
tive accept
(
)
faster for the common ca
s
e
commit
|
commitdiff
|
tree
2009-05-03
Er
i
c Wong
Add TUNING doc
u
m
e
nt
commit
|
commitdiff
|
tree
2009-05-03
Eric Won
g
a
p
p
/exec_cgi: GC prev
e
ntion
commit
|
commitdiff
|
tree
2009-04-29
Eric Wong
Add example ini
t
s
c
rip
t
commit
|
commitdiff
|
tree
2009-04-27
Eri
c
Wo
n
g
test
_
upload: still uncomf
o
rtable with 1
.
9
I
O
encoding
.
.
.
commit
|
commitdiff
|
tree
2009-04-26
Eric Wo
n
g
Sm
a
ll cle
a
nu
p
commit
|
commitdiff
|
tree
2009-04-25
Eric Wong
t
e
st_request
:
enable
w
i
th Ruby 1
.
9 now Rack 1
.
0
.
0 is
out
commit
|
commitdiff
|
tree
2009-04-25
Eric Wong
u
n
icorn
0
.
7
.
0
commit
|
commitdiff
|
tree
2009-04-25
E
r
ic Wong
Rack
1
.
0
.
0
compatibili
t
y
commit
|
commitdiff
|
tree
2009-04-25
Eric Wong
Fix log rotation being delayed in work
e
rs when id
l
e
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
conf
i
gu
r
ator: "liste
n
"
directive mo
r
e nginx-like
commit
|
commitdiff
|
tree
2009-04-24
E
r
i
c
Wong
doc: formatting
c
hanges for SIGNALS
doc
commit
|
commitdiff
|
tree
2009-04-24
Eric
W
ong
unicorn 0
.
6
.
0
commit
|
commitdiff
|
tree
2009-04-24
Eric
Wong
c
l
eanup: avoid
dup
e
d self
-
pipe ini
t
/
replaceme
n
t logic
commit
|
commitdiff
|
tree
2009-04-24
E
r
ic Wong
SIGTT
{
I
N,
O
U} {in
,
de}crements worker_processes
commit
|
commitdiff
|
tree
2009-04-24
E
r
ic Wong
Allow std{err,
o
u
t}_path to be changed via
H
UP
commit
|
commitdiff
|
tree
2009-04-24
E
ric Wong
minor cleanups and
sa
v
e
a few var
i
able
s
commit
|
commitdiff
|
tree
2009-04-24
Eri
c
Wong
A
voi
d
getppid() if serving
h
e
a
vy
t
raffic
commit
|
commitdiff
|
tree
2009-04-24
Eric
W
ong
Fixup
r
eference to a dead v
a
riable
commit
|
commitdiff
|
tree
2009-04-24
Eric
W
ong
Descri
b
e
the global co
n
stants we
u
se
.
commit
|
commitdiff
|
tree
2009-04-24
Eric
Won
g
make SELF_PIPE is
a
global constant
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
http_r
e
s
p
on
s
e:
minor performance gains
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
http_resp
o
nse:
just
b
a
r
e
ly faster
commit
|
commitdiff
|
tree
2009-04-24
Er
i
c Wong
test_socket_helper: disab
l
e GC fo
r
this test
commit
|
commitdiff
|
tree
2009-04-24
Eric
W
ong
Make LISTENERS and WORKERS glo
b
al cons
t
ants, too
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
IO_PURGATO
R
Y
shoul
d
be
a
g
lobal constant
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
http_request: micro opti
m
izations
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
M
erge c
o
mmi
t
'
v
0
.
5
.
4'
commit
|
commitdiff
|
tree
2009-04-24
Eri
c
Wong
test_ex
e
c
:
cleanup stale socket on ex
i
t
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
unicor
n
_
r
ails: avoid nesting lambdas
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
GNUmakefile: mark test_upload as a slow
t
est
commit
|
commitdiff
|
tree
2009-04-24
Eri
c
Wong
Get rid o
f
U
N
IC
O
RN_TMP
_
BASE constant
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
u
n
i
corn 0
.
5
.
4
commit
|
commitdiff
|
tree
2009-04-24
Eric Wong
Fix data corruption
w
ith small uplo
a
ds via browse
r
s
commit
|
commitdiff
|
tree
2009-04-24
E
r
ic Wong
Fix data corruption w
i
th sma
l
l upload
s
via browsers
commit
|
commitdiff
|
tree
2009-04-22
Eric Wong
Cl
e
anup GNUmakefil
e
and
f
ix de
p
e
n
d
e
nci
e
s
commit
|
commitdiff
|
tree
2009-04-22
Eric Wong
Cleanup some unnecessary requires
commit
|
commitdiff
|
tree
2009-04-21
E
ric Wong
tes
t
:
e
mpty
port test for
absolu
t
e
U
RIs
commit
|
commitdiff
|
tree
2009-04-21
Eric
W
ong
http
1
1:
s
upp
o
rt u
n
d
er
s
cores in U
R
I
hostna
m
es
commit
|
commitdiff
|
tree
2009-04-21
Eric
W
ong
Remove @s
t
art
_
ct
x
i
n
stance variable
commit
|
commitdiff
|
tree
2009-04-21
Eric Wong
rename soc
k
e
t
.
rb =
>
socket_helper
.
r
b
commit
|
commitdiff
|
tree
2009-04-21
Eric Wo
n
g
Stop ex
t
e
n
ding
core classes
commit
|
commitdiff
|
tree
2009-04-21
Eric W
o
ng
ht
t
p
_
r
espo
n
se: small speedup
by eliminating
loop
commit
|
commitdiff
|
tree
2009-04-21
Eric Wong
http
1
1: rfc2616 handling
of absolute URIs
commit
|
commitdiff
|
tree
2009-04-21
Eric Wong
http11: cle
a
n
up some CP
P
macros
commit
|
commitdiff
|
tree
2009-04-21
Eric Wong
http11: make parser o
b
ey
HTTP_HOST with
e
m
pty port
commit
|
commitdiff
|
tree
2009-04-21
E
r
ic Won
g
htt
p
1
1:
m
inor cleanups in return types
commit
|
commitdiff
|
tree
2009-04-21
Eric W
o
ng
replace DATA_GE
T
macro w
i
th
a
func
t
ion
commit
|
commitdiff
|
tree
next